The brainchild of Argentinean architect and industrial designer Emilio Ambasz, a father of the sustainability movement, who was concerned with maintaining the green space of the adjacent existing Tenjin Central Park while providing the city with a mixed-use, symbolic building, he effectively doubled the size of the park by creating 15 low, landscaped stepped terraces, thus compensating for human intrusion on nature. In land-scarce Japan, the Hall acts as both building and garden, giving back to Fukuoka’s population what it has taken from the city and thereby demonstrating that an urban megastructure can coexist with an open public space, that parks aren’t just for the outskirts. In an essay entitled “Sustainability’s Transubstantiation” published in the May 2010 issue of Italian architecture and design magazine Domus, Ambasz wrote: “I am lucky to have been able to demonstrate with the ACROS building that we can have ‘the green over the gray’ in the city, that it is not true that greenery is only possible in the suburbs, that heat and cold loads can be also greatly reduced using a very economical and ecological material par excellence such as earth and plants are, and that you can have 100 percent of the land and also 100 percent of the building, that is to say, we can have ‘the house and the garden’ instead of ‘the house in the garden’ (say 40 percent for the house and 60 percent for the garden), as Modernism promised us in its beginnings.”, According to Ambasz, does façade greening really trap air pollutants and improve air quality, cool the air significantly, absorb noise and provide animal habitats? Its roof is tiered at each floor to maximize space for the garden which contains a total of 50,000 plants and trees of 120 species. The ACROS Fukuoka Prefectural International Hall provides a grand mixed-use space for concerts and events but avoids displacing any of the green space of the park through its innovative terraced design. Aware that foliage-covered façades don’t automatically equate to sustainable architecture, Ambasz’s wish was to give back to the community the land enveloped by the building as much as possible by designing a building so closely linked to its surrounding landscape that it was impossible to tell one from the other, and decorating the building with seasonally-changing ornamentation, such as vegetation is, installing earth and plants on roofs and walls to create gardens. [For the last four decades], I have endeavored to return to the community as much as possible, not a few times, 100 percent of the land the building’s footprint covers. Saved by Onchanok Nawapruek. The building appears to seamlessly extend the park (the last piece of green space in Fukuoka’s city center) onto its entire south façade through a series of terraced gardens for a continuous green surface, ideal for exercise, meditation and relaxation away from the congestion of the city. The Acros building is a 15-storey building in central Fukuoka designed to look like a hanging garden. It uses vegetation on its façade and rooftop to promote an energy-efficient and environmentally-friendly building envelope, taking into account the public’s need for green space in city areas, while ensuring the commercial developer’s desire for profitable use of the site, thereby reconciling two often incompatible ideas and creating an innovative agro-urban model. The city even adopted his initial sketch of the green building’s profile for use on its official stationery, considering that it embodied the image that Fukuoka wished to project of itself. ... Inside the building is more than 1,000,000 sqft of multipurpose space spread over 14 floors containing an exhibition hall, museum, proscenium theater, conference rooms, governmental and private offices, centered around a full-height atrium, and four underground levels of parking and retail facilities.
